In the dynamic landscape of product development and market research, gaining a profound understanding of user needs and behaviors is paramount.

While quantitative methods offer valuable data points, they often fail to capture the nuances regarding human experience. In-depth interviews emerge as a powerful tool for delving into the minds of users, revealing their motivations, pain points, and aspirations.

Through structured yet flexible conversations, researchers can obtain rich qualitative insights. Users are encouraged to elaborate on their experiences, thoughts, and feelings, providing a holistic view of their interactions with products or services.

Additionally, in-depth interviews allow for the exploration of complex topics that may be difficult to quantify.

By actively listening and probing for deeper understanding, researchers can uncover unexpected insights that drive innovation and improve user satisfaction.

Ultimately, in-depth interviews serve as a vital bridge between users and product developers, fostering empathy and guiding the creation of truly user-centric solutions.

Finding the Right Participants: Strategies for Effective Recruitment

Ensuring your research project accomplishes its objectives hinges on identifying and recruiting the perfect participants. A well-defined intended population is crucial, outlining the qualities that make a participant appropriate.

Once you've identified your target audience, crafting compelling solicitation materials becomes paramount. Clearly describe the purpose of your study and stress the significance of participation.

To increase reach, explore diverse avenues.

Consider online platforms like social media or dedicated research groups, alongside traditional methods such as flyers and community partnerships.

Remember, transparency about your study is essential to build assurance with potential participants. Provide concise information about the activities involved, expected time commitment, and any possible risks or perks.

By implementing these approaches, you can engage a diverse pool of participants who are motivated to contribute to your research endeavors.

Constructing Compelling Surveys: Tools and Techniques for Data Collection

Gathering reliable data by surveys can prove invaluable for gaining insight into your respondents. However, crafting effective surveys necessitates careful consideration.

A well-structured survey must be concise and simple to grasp. Use clear and precise language, omitting jargon or technical terms that may confuse respondents.

  • Furthermore, provide a selection of question styles to engage your audience. Consider incorporating multiple-choice questions, free response questions, and scaling questions.
  • Additionally, employ survey tools that provide features such as automated data collection and result tracking.

Software like Qualtrics can ease the survey development process and furnish valuable insights. Remember in mind that the accuracy of your data relies on the deliberate design and implementation of your survey.

Leveraging Survey Tools: Maximizing Response Rates and Insights

Unlocking valuable insights from your target audience requires a strategic approach to survey design and implementation. When crafting surveys, prioritize concise questions that are easy to understand and respond to. Employ a variety of question types, such as multiple choice, rating scales, and open-ended queries, to capture diverse perspectives.

To maximize response rates, utilize clear calls to action and emphasize the relevance of participant feedback. Offer incentives for completing the survey, such as gift cards or exclusive content, to incentivize participation. Furthermore, distribute your survey through multiple channels, including email, social media, and online forums, to connect with a wider audience.

Once you've collected responses, leverage powerful data analysis tools to extract meaningful patterns and trends. Visualize your findings in clear and compelling charts, graphs, and dashboards to disseminate key insights effectively. By following these best practices, you can optimize the value of your survey data and drive informed decision-making.
